Most people simply enjoy having their day off on the the 1st of May in France. Trade Unions traditionally demonstrate in Paris and in the major French towns. These demonstrations are always non-confrontational and well planed by the unions and the police chiefs.

What do french people celebrate on 14th July?

The 14th of July is the National Day in France. It is the anniversary of the storming of the Bastille, a castle and prison, on the 14th of July, 1789, marking the beginning of the French revolution.
